Women's golf finishes second at Skyhawk Invitational; Vincent takes third

PINE MOUNTAIN, Ga. – The Lindsey Wilson women's golf team turned in a second place finish at the Skyhawk Invitational. The Blue Raiders finishing the two-round tournament held at Callaway Gardens – a par 72, 5,803-yard course -- with a total score of 613.

The total was just one stroke off the pace set by tournament champions Southeastern (Fla.) who was able to score a 612 over two rounds. Faulkner (Ala.) finished in third place after turning in a 620 for the tournament.

Courtney Vincent led the charge for the Blue Raiders. Carrying the lead after the first round with a tournament-low 69-stroke round, Vincent would post a 79 on day two to finish in third place at four-over par.

Dacie Bolton also finished inside the top-5. After firing a 77 on the first day of competition, Bolton would produce a 73 during the second round to finish in a three-way tie for fifth.

Bo Young Park would just miss out on a top-10 finish. After starting the day seven-over, Park managed to record a three-over par 75 to finish in a three-way tie for 11th.

Tara Rodenhurst was the only other Blue Raider to compete at the tournament as she posted a two-round total of 161 (80-81) to finish in a tie for 31st place.

The Blue Raiders are back in action on Thursday and Friday when they compete at the Spring Break Invitational at Grand National Lake Course in Opelika, Alabama.
